2. Fiosrachadh Sàbhailteachd
- Sàbhailteachd dealain: Always ensure correct voltage and current are applied. Exceeding the rated voltage (3V-3.2V) or current (250mA) can damage the LED.
- Polarity: LEDs are polarity-sensitive. Connect the anode (longer lead) to the positive (+) terminal and the cathode (shorter lead) to the negative (-) terminal. Incorrect polarity will prevent the LED from lighting up and can cause damage.
- Teas: While LEDs are efficient, prolonged operation at maximum current can generate heat. Ensure adequate heat dissipation if used in enclosed spaces or at high currents.
- Dìon sùla: Do not stare directly into a lit LED, especially at high brightness, as it can cause temporary discomfort or eye strain.
- Làimhseachadh: Handle leads carefully to avoid bending or breaking. Static electricity can damage sensitive electronic components; use anti-static precautions if necessary.

4.2 Uèirleadh agus Poilearachd
LEDs are diodes, meaning current flows in one direction. Correct polarity is crucial for operation.
- Anode (+): This is the positive lead. It is typically the nas fhaide of the two leads.
- Cathode (-): This is the negative lead. It is typically the nas giorra of the two leads.
- Connect the anode to the positive output of your power source and the cathode to the negative output.
4.3 Current Limiting Resistor
To protect the LED from excessive current and ensure its longevity, a current-limiting resistor is almost always required in series with the LED. The resistor value depends on your power supply voltage and the desired current. Use Ohm's Law (R = (Vs - Vf) / If) to calculate the appropriate resistor value, where:
- R: Resistor value in Ohms (Ω)
- Vs: Solarachadh voltage (e.g., 5V, 9V, 12V)
- Vf: LED forward voltage (typically 3.0V for these white LEDs)
- Ma tha: Desired forward current (e.g., 20mA for general use, up to 250mA for maximum brightness)
Example: For a 5V supply and a desired 20mA (0.02A) current:
R = (5V - 3.0V) / 0.02A = 2V / 0.02A = 100 Ω
Always use a resistor value equal to or greater than the calculated value.
5. Stiùireadh Obrachaidh
Once properly wired with a current-limiting resistor and connected to a suitable DC power source (3V-3.2V), the LED will illuminate. These LEDs are designed for continuous operation within their specified parameters.
- Iarrtasan: Suitable for DIY PCB board circuits, Arduino projects, Raspberry Pi, hobby electronics, science experiments, breadboard prototyping, and as replacement bulbs.
- Smachd soilleireachd: The brightness can be adjusted by varying the forward current (within the 250mA maximum) using a different resistor value or a constant current driver.
